(2) The bulls shall be certified by the Authority in such manner and subject to such conditions, as may be specified by the Government.
(3) The Authority shall, generate a unique Identification No. for each certified bull and it shall be mandatory for the semen stations to tag this unique Identification No. securely and permanently to the certified bulls at all times.
12. The trained AI workers shall be certified by the Authority in such manner and subject to such conditions, as may be specified by the Government.
13. (I) None shall sell or distribute or gift or transfer the semen/embryo to any person other than a person, as may be authorized by "the Authority
(2) No semen/embryo produced outside the State-of Punjab shall be allowed into the State of Punjab to be sold, distributed or gifted for Artificial Insemination/transfer, except with the prior approval of the Authority to be granted in such manner and subject to such conditions, as may he prescribed.
(3) No semen/embryo shall be imported for Artificial Insemination/ transfer in to the State of Punjab from any other country, except with the prior approval of the Authority to be granted in such manner and subject to such conditions, as may be prescribed. .,
14. In case a certificate of registration or a certificate of renewal issued under this Act is defaced, lost or destroyed, the Authority, may, upon satisfaction, grant a duplicate certificate to the applicant on payment of such fee, as maybe prescribed.

16. (I) Any person aggrieved by an order of the Authority refusing to Appeal.
grant or renew a certificate of registration or revoking or suspending the certificate of registration under the provisions of this Act, may file an appeal before the Appellate Authority, who shall be the Administrative Secretary of:
the Department of Animal Husbandry, Punjab, j !'•« •; - , s
(2) The Appellate Authority, after giving a reasonable opportunity of being heard to the applicant, shall decide the appeal, as expeditiously as possible, but within three months.
